Currently, Squarespace does not offer a direct “Squarespace post a blog post API” as part of its native features. Users can achieve Squarespace connections with alternative services and tools such as Zapier to link the platforms together. The automated solutions make blog post creation and posting possible which reduces workflow needs and saves time for users.

Squarespace includes API support features such as integration with its Developer Platform. The functionality provided by Squarespace stands behind WordPress and Shopify in terms of platform capabilities.
Squarespace Scheduling API for booking integrations.
Unfortunately, there is no native “Squarespace post a blog post API” to automate publishing blog posts.
Squarespace provides APIs that mainly address e-commerce operations together with scheduling options. The main task of content management including automated blog posting needs users to use third-party tools in addition to creating custom solutions.

Squarespace does not provide its customers the option to use a built-in “post a blog post API.” The built-in Squarespace tools lack the capability to conduct automated blog posting.
The connection between Squarespace and external apps is made possible through third-party platforms Zapier and Make (formerly Integromat). The tools provide users with the capability to link Squarespace to other applications through which they can automate workflows.
The workflow automation tool Zapier enables you to create a setup between publishing content to Squarespace automatically after it appears on either WordPress or Google Docs.
The Developer Platform from Squarespace allows users to implement custom API integrations as an alternative solution. The development of business-specific solutions requires you to employ a developer to create the needed applications.
